gitk: Allow unbalanced quotes/braces in commit headers
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
When parsing commits, gitk treats the headers of the commit as tcl
lists.  This causes errors if the header contains an unbalanced quote
or open brace.  Splitting the line on spaces allows us to treat it as
a set of words instead of as a tcl list, which prevents errors.
